Start at Birch Island on Hwy 6 south of Espanola (marina) East through McGregor Bay Through East & West Channels Camp night one at park boundary East through Kirk Creek including portages of : P 75 m, P 40 ,P 50, P 50 m, P 75 m, P 20 m, P 50 m Northeast through Theenarrows Lake P 540 m at narrows Camp night two on Threenarrows P 395 m to small unnamed lake P 3160 m to Killarney Lake East on Killarney Lake East on Chikanashing Creek (liftover at log jam and beaver dam) P 250 m to Norway Lake East through Norway Lake Camp night three on Norway Lake P 1470 m to Kakakise Lake West through Kakakise Lake West through Kakakise Creek (or P 1975 m beside creek if dry) West through Freeland Lake P 80 m R around old dam West then south through George Lake to finish at main campground
The maze of islands between Birch Island and Killarney Provincial Park can make navigation confusing. Keep track of your position on the topo map carefully. The long portage on this trip (3160 m) between Threenarrows and Killarney is not as difficult as it might seem. It has a steep section at the beginning and end, but the centre is quite level
